The diet gods have finally heard my prayers. I am a huge fan of caeser salads and junk salads topped with creamy ranch dressing. Neither one of those dressings are anywhere close to being healthy nor can you limit yourself to just a little bit - it’s just not fun! Much to my surprise Wishbone introduced their salad spritzers last summer and out of the 4 flavors offered Caesar was one along with Raspberry Vinaigrette, Asian Silk, and Classic Italian.
I have continued to wonder if they would expand their offerings. I would think that dieters on any program would flock to these dressings as they taste incredibly good - not like fat free or diet dressings. Much to my happiness, I was wandering around Target 2 weeks ago and just happened to walk around the small food section (I have a regular Target not a Super Target nearby) and lo and behold there it was: Spray Ranch Dressing by Wishbone. I was super excited as I had not even heard this was a possibility through the rumor mill and Hungrygirl usually knows what is coming and when.
My official review: Very tasty and easy to use. It is a tad odd spraying white colored liquid on my salad but it tastes just like ranch dressing so I cannot complain. I believe the official point conversion is 1 serving size which is 10 sprays for 1/2 point in weight watchers. The nutritionals are 10 sprays for 15 calories, 1 gm fat, and 0 gm fiber. If you are a fan of Ranch Dressing I highly recommend you check your local grocery store for the Ranch Salad Spritzer.
